Mitanni , also called Hanigalbat or Hani-Rabbat (Hanikalbat, Khanigalbat, cuneiform ???????????????? Ḫa-ni-gal-bat, Ḫa-ni-rab-bat) in Assyrian or Naharin in Egyptian texts, was a Hurrian-speaking state in northern Syria and southeast Anatolia. Mitanni var ett forntida rike i nuvarande norra Syrien cirka 1500–1300 f.Kr. Rikets kärnområde låg i Khaburs floddal där hurriter utgjorde majoriteten av befolkningen. När riket stod på höjden av sin makt var det minst lika mäktigt i Främre Orienten som Egypten och Babylon. Det omfattade då ett område från den syriska Medelhavskusten i väster, över södra Anatolien och norra Mesopotamien till Zagros bergskedja i öster.
